Please talk to me about your 12 yr olds and gaming in the holidays

As, it appears, like many of his peers, DS would spend every waking moment gaming. In term time we have quite strict rules but I have been lapse this week as we returned from holiday and I have had a full on week for various reasons. But I am interested to hear tips about how others regulate use of consoles during the holidays. Any attempt at discussion usually results in strops and eye rolls so would like to hear your rules please.

DH's rule is "If they get outside for a good spell in the day then don't regulate the gaming time"

I had time limits (eg. 2 hrs/day) for yrs, when I was SAHP. That was a lot more work than DH's system.

Same as lijk's DH. My general rule is, you're not sitting inside on a console all day every day. I've told mine to make plans with their friends or they come out with me somewhere. They have also been 'strongly encouraged' to do a couple of summer activity camps.
